Dive deep into his world through this comprehensive book, which features a curated collection of his graffiti work, paintings, installations, and photography. Gain insights into McGee's artistic process and vision through an insightful interview with Germano Celant, a renowned curator from the Solomon R. Guggenheim Museum in New York.
